LOS ANGELES, Dec. 7 (UPI) -- British author J.K. Rowling came out at No. 1 on U.S. TV personality Barbara Walters' list of 2007's "Most Fascinating People."
Rowling released "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ows," the seventh and final novel in her blockbuster boy wizard series, and saw the successful release of the fifth hit "Harry Potter" film this year.
Also making Walters' year-end list are Victoria and David Beckham, Justin Timberlake, Katherine Heigl, Jennifer Hudson, Don Imus, Bill Clinton and Hugo Chavez.
"I think it is a great list because we have people from business, we have people from politics, we have movie stars, we have sexy stars, we have singing stars," Walters told "Access Hollywood."
